"A Hidden Gem of an Album by artist-cat (Aussie, Aussie, Aussie, oi, oi, oi)
Marc Leon may not be a household name in the world of rock music - but like most blues players his work gets noticed by those who appreciate good sounds.
A much underrated guitarist and vocalist - his playing is reminscent of Dickey Betts and Eric Clapton, with a bit of Larry Carlton thrown in for good measure.
This album is a mix of blues roots music, hard driving rock and jazz fusion. You can hear a bit of Robert Johnson in the opening shots of "Shoot from the Hip" and then pure rock in (my favorite) "No Friends in High Places", which should be a hit single if it ever gets radio airplay. The blues and rock continues until the pace slows down near the end - where subtle yet complex jazz/ rock/ fusion sounds spill out in "Capricornica" and "Escorpiona".
A versitile and varied album from an excellent musician. It should probably be titled 'the Best of Marc Leon' - but maybe there's more to come...
If you like this - get an album by his former band "Whipping Post" called 'Damn the Distance'. It has an outstanding track on it called 'Roll on Central', which
unfortuneately is missing from this Special Edition CD. Oh well, you can't have everything..."
